Journey to the Unknown: The Metaphorical Drive to Heaven

Deep Dish's song "Escape (Driving to heaven)" is a profound exploration of the human desire to break free from the mundane and venture into the unknown.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of a journey, both literal and metaphorical, where the protagonist is driving towards a place of ultimate freedom and transcendence, symbolized by 'heaven.' The repeated phrase, "I’m driving to heaven," suggests a quest for something greater, a place where the constraints of everyday life no longer apply.

The song begins with a sense of hesitation and disconnection. The protagonist feels out of place, surrounded by people who are 'pale and faded,' indicating a lack of vitality and enthusiasm in their environment. This sense of disillusionment is further emphasized by the line, "The air had been confiscated," suggesting a stifling atmosphere where even the basic act of breathing feels restricted. The protagonist's eyes are 'dilated,' a possible metaphor for heightened awareness or a state of altered perception, indicating a readiness to escape the current reality.

As the journey progresses, the protagonist experiences a sense of liberation. The traffic is 'syncopated,' implying a break from the usual rhythm of life, and the car becomes a vessel for transformation, 'turning them on' and propelling them towards their destination. The repeated assertion that there is 'no way back home' underscores the irreversible nature of this journey. It’s a one-way trip to a new state of being, where the protagonist seeks to find meaning and fulfillment beyond the confines of their previous existence.

Deep Dish, known for their innovative approach to electronic music, uses this song to blend deep, introspective lyrics with a driving beat, creating an immersive experience that resonates with listeners on multiple levels. The song's themes of escape, transformation, and the search for a higher purpose are universal, making it a timeless piece that continues to inspire and provoke thought.
